INT. BOOKSTORE-DAY

Annie and Alvy browsing in crowded bookstore. Alvy, carrying two books,
"Death and Western Thought" and "The Denial of Death", moves over to where
Annie is looking.

ALVY
Hey?

ANNIE
H'm?

ALVY
I-I-I'm gonna buy you these books, I
think, because I-I think you should
read them. You know, instead of that
cat book.

ANNIE
(Looking at the books Alvy
is bolding)
That's, uh ...
(Laughing)
that's pretty serious stuff there.

ALVY
Yeah, 'cause I-I'm, you know, I'm,
I'm obsessed with-with, uh, with death,
I think. Big-

ANNIE
(Overlapping)
Yeah?

ALVY
-big subject with me, yeah.

ANNIE
Yeah?

They move over to the cashier line.

ALVY
(Gesturing)
I've a very pessimistic view of life.
You should know this about me if we're
gonna go out, you know. I-I-I feel that
life is-is divided up into the horrible
and the miserable.

ANNIE
M'hm.

ALVY
Those are the two categories ...

ANNIE
M'hm.

ALVY
... you know, they're- The-the horrible
would be like, uh, I don't know, terminal
cases, you know?

ANNIE
M'hm.

ALVY
And blind people, crippled ...

ANNIE
Yeah.

ALVY
I don't-don't know how they get through
life. It's amazing to me.

ANNIE
M'hm.

ALVY
You know, and the miserable is everyone
else. That's-that's all. So-so when
you go through life you should be thankful
that you're miserable, because that's-
You're very lucky ... to be ...
(Overlapping Annie's laughter)
... to be miserable.

ANNIE
U-huh.
